Overview:

 

Assures the delivery of safe, quality, and cost-efficient care by competent staff members in perioperative services. Ensures efficient utilization of available resources and meets productivity and/or financial goals. Meets customer satisfaction goals. Works collaboratively and effectively with other administrative personnel, physicians, and staff from other areas throughout the Health System to enhance communication, share pertinent data, and improve processes across the continuum. Performs related duties as assigned. Performs duties and responsibilities in a manner consistent with our mission, values, and Mercy Service Standards.

 

Qualifications:

 

  • Education: Bachelor’s degree Required
  • Licensure: Current RN License
  • Experience: Bachelor’s Degree with 5 years of progressive management experience required with 3 years in management of perioperative services.
  • Certification/Registration: Other skills & knowledge: Basic knowledge of the perioperative environment (skills, knowledge, abilities)
  • Preferred Education: Master’s degree
